A police officer walking on a street in the central Gia Lai Province was killed instantly after being hit by a pair of detached container truck wheels.

Captain Pham Hong Vuong, 33, of the An Nhon Bac Ward police department, was walking along National Highway 19B on Saturday afternoon when a container truck driven by Le Duc Loi, a local, traveling in the same direction, suddenly had an axle shaft broken, causing a pair of wheels to fly off.

The wheels struck Vuong from behind.

They then continued to roll, damaging two parked motorbikes.

A wheel can weigh 45-160 kg depending on the size of the container truck, which could be 20 feet or 40 feet long.

Vuong is married with two children.
